Nairobi, Kenya — A US-based Kenyan nurse and social media influencer widely known as Nurse Judy has sparked conversation among health professionals back home by encouraging Kenyan nurses to pursue nursing opportunities in the United States.
In a recent Instagram post, she highlighted not only the professional prospects but also the potential financial gains that can come with working overseas.

Judy, who has built a significant following on Instagram for sharing insights into nursing careers abroad, emphasized that many Kenyan nurses can dramatically increase their income by relocating.
According to her message, nursing in the USA has enabled her to earn the equivalent of up to KSh 1.3 million per week — a figure far above typical nursing salaries in Kenya.
Why Focus on the United States?
Judy’s message is rooted in the reality that nursing pay and conditions in Kenya are often modest compared to what is available in many developed countries.

In Kenya, registered nurses generally earn monthly salaries in the range of tens of thousands of Kenyan shillings, with most public-sector roles paying between approximately KSh 55,000 and KSh 110,000 per month, depending on experience and role.

Reactions from Kenyan Social Media
Her message has received mixed reactions from Kenyans online.
Some healthcare professionals and aspiring nurses find Judy’s advice inspiring, highlighting the opportunities beyond local healthcare settings.
Others have raised concerns about the brain drain effect — where qualified nurses leave Kenya, potentially worsening staffing shortages in the local health sector.
